The OpenNET Project / Index page

[ новости/++ | форум | wiki | теги ]

Как обновить содержимое установочного DVD для Fedora Core 5 Linux
Копируем обновления на локальную машину
http://download.fedora.redhat.com/pub/fedora/linux/core/updates/5/i386/

Создаем директорию, в которой будем создавать новый образ диска.
   mkdir -p /opt/FC_2006.4/i386
   cd /opt/FC_2006.4

Монтируем оригинальный установочный диск
   mount -o loop /full/path/FC-5-i386-DVD.iso /mnt

и синхронизируем его содержимое, за исключением rpm пакетов, в созданную ранее директорию.
   rsync --archive --exclude 'Fedora/RPMS/*.rpm' /mnt/ i386

Копируем только актуальные rpm пакеты для которых не было обновлений. 
Наличие обновлений отслеживаем при помощи утилиры novi.
   for fn in `novi path/to/updates /mnt/Fedora/RPMS/ | awk '{print $2}'`; do
     cp $fn i386/Fedora/RPMS/
   done

Обновляем индексные файлы
   cd i386
   createrepo -u "media://1142397575.182477#1" -g Fedora/base/comps.xml .
   cd ..

Создаем ISO образ и md5 слепок.
   mkisofs -R -J -T -v -no-emul-boot -boot-load-size 4 -boot-info-table \
     -V "Fedora Core 5 (Patched.0406)" -b isolinux/isolinux.bin \
     -c isolinux/boot.cat -x "lost+found" -o FC5-i386-dvd-patched.iso i386

   /usr/lib/anaconda-runtime/implantisomd5 FC5-i386-dvd-patched.iso
 
02.05.2006 , Автор: Rob Garth , Источник: http://www.users.on.net/~rgarth/web...
Ключи: fedora, linux, dvd, iso, install, boot, rpm / Лицензия: CC-BY
Раздел:    Корень / Администратору / Система / Linux специфика / Установка и работа с пакетами программ в Linux

Обсуждение [ RSS ]
 
  • 1.1, Lamo, 13:01, 02/05/2006 [ответить] [смотреть все]
  • +/
    А как из установочных CD сделать DVD?
     
  • 1.2, Andrew, 00:48, 10/05/2006 [ответить] [смотреть все]
  • +/
    В блоге комменты нормальные.
     
  • 1.3, dsl, 09:36, 12/05/2006 [ответить] [смотреть все]
  • +/
    здорово.

    кстати вот это:
    "
    Обновляем индексные файлы
       cd i386
       createrepo -u "media://1142397575.182477#1" -g Fedora/base/comps.xml .
       cd ..
    "
    появилось только из за того FC5 перешли на yum или пройдет для любого другого дистрибутива?

     
     
  • 2.4, Zerg, 12:35, 17/05/2006 [^] [ответить] [смотреть все]
  • +/
    Хммм, господа, а можно глупый вопрос ?
    а что за утилита novi ???
    впервые о такой слышу :(
    И в каком пакете ее брать ?

     
     
  • 3.5, Andrew, 03:27, 02/06/2006 [^] [ответить] [смотреть все]
  • +/
    На оригинальном сайте описано.
     
  • 1.6, Janis, 01:50, 06/07/2006 [ответить] [смотреть все]  
  • +/
    kstae: kusok s novi dolzhen vygljadetj tak:

    for fn in 'novi path/to/updates /mnt/Fedora/RPMS | awk '{print $3}''; do cp $fn i386/Fedora/RPMS/ done

    pod nomerom 2 awk vyrezajet nje to...

     
  • 1.7, Janis, 02:15, 06/07/2006 [ответить] [смотреть все]  
  • +/
    koroche - nado ustanavljivatj 3 paketa:
    1. novi (naod kompiljirovatj, po krainjei mere dlja x86_64 u yum-a ni chevo njetu)
    2. createrepo
    3. anaconda-runtime
     
  • 1.8, lin, 14:41, 19/02/2007 [ответить] [смотреть все]  
  • +/
    мне нада  закинуть rpm пакетик  с прогой  на  образ FC-6-i386-DVD.iso как  мне  обойтись без  утилиты  NOVI?мне  просто нада  произвести индексирование  пакетика  чтобы  он устанавливался  без всяких ошибок.что  посоветует?очень  нада произвести  такую фишку.
     
  • 1.9, lin, 12:55, 24/02/2007 [ответить] [смотреть все]  
  • +/
    хмм   наверно  мне ни кто не  сможет  помочь...
     

    Ваш комментарий
    Имя:         
    E-Mail:      
    Заголовок:
    Текст:



      Закладки на сайте
      Проследить за страницей
    Created 1996-2017 by Maxim Chirkov  
    ДобавитьРекламаВебмастеруГИД  
    Hosting by Ihor